It’s up to the Texans to stop the Tampa Bay Buccaneers from clinching their division this Sunday. It won’t be easy, though. The Texans are 5-7 and may be without their starting quarterback Matt Schaub, who injured his non-throwing arm. The Bucs improved to 8-and-4 and have opened up a three-game lead in the NFC South. Bucs star quarterback Jeff Garcia wants to play this Sunday, but Coach Jon Gruden is tight-lipped about whether he’ll let Garcia back on the field. Garcia is nursing a sore back.
